A powerful, affirming picture book that uplifts, educates, and inspires Black boys to see themselves as heroes of their own story.
They are inventors, leaders, athletes, scholars, artists. They are sons, dreamers, and doers. Black Boy, Black Boy is a lyrical celebration of possibility and pride—perfect for parents, educators, and caregivers who want every Black child to grow up knowing they matter, they shine, and they belong.
This acclaimed picture book offers an empowering message of confidence and cultural heritage, paired with vibrant illustrations and rhythmic, read-aloud-ready text. From historical trailblazers like Elijah McCoy and Sam Cooke to present-day role models like Colin Kaepernick, the book honors the legacies that light the way forward for a new generation.
